This role sits within the Tax COE Europe team. The 2 main aspects of the role are:
• To take responsibility for and to manage VAT reporting compliance requirements for a group of markets within Europe region and other international markets, as required, ensuring internal and external deadlines are met.
• To provide advice on VAT compliance related queries, coordinating with external and internal stakeholders where necessary.
• In addition, the person is expected to maintain a constant awareness of local VAT legislation and act as a real internal consultant to satisfy stakeholder expectations.
MAJOR D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ES:
• Preparation of monthly, bi-monthly, quarterly or annual VAT returns and other indirect tax returns (sales listings, domestic listings, purchase listings, Intrastat, SAF-T) using Excel and/or indirect tax return preparation tool technology
• Preparing and requesting necessary VAT submission approvals from internal stakeholders and following up on VAT payment requests and archiving documentation after submissions are completed
• Preparation of VAT General Ledger reconciliation and follow up on issues and open items
• Reconciliation of GL sales to reported VAT sales and follow up on issues and open items
• Manage and assist with VAT compliance queries from the business as necessary
• Support preparing VAT requirements documents and other documents as needed
• Support Tax Technology team to test and implement requirements on a timely basis, as necessary
• Continuous monitor of VAT legislation to identify relevant changes
• Assistance in maintenance of VAT codes tables and VAT codes in accounting system
• Assistance with VAT audits and liaison with tax authorities as necessary
• Support strategy of standardisation and automation, continuous improvement and risk management
